Construction ERP licensing is a strategic decision, not just a procurement exercise
For construction companies, ERP selection is rarely driven by accounting alone. The real decision sits at the intersection of project-based scaling, contract complexity, subcontractor coordination, cost control, field execution, and executive visibility. That is why a construction ERP licensing comparison should evaluate more than subscription fees or named-user counts. It should assess how licensing structure affects operational flexibility, implementation scope, reporting consistency, and long-term modernization options.
In this comparison, Odoo is evaluated against traditional construction ERP licensing approaches commonly found in legacy or industry-specific platforms. These alternatives often include modular licensing, per-user pricing, implementation-heavy customization, third-party field service add-ons, and infrastructure constraints that can materially change total cost of ownership over time. The goal is not to position one platform as universally superior, but to clarify where Odoo fits best for contractors, developers, EPC firms, specialty trades, and project-driven construction businesses.
Executive summary: where Odoo stands in a construction ERP comparison
Odoo is typically strongest for construction businesses that want a flexible, modular ERP platform capable of supporting estimating, procurement, project accounting, subcontractor workflows, inventory, equipment, timesheets, invoicing, and financial management within a unified architecture. Its licensing model is often more adaptable for growing firms that need to add users, entities, workflows, or custom processes without entering a highly fragmented software stack.
Traditional construction ERP platforms may remain attractive for organizations with highly specialized requirements such as advanced job costing conventions, deeply embedded construction accounting practices, union payroll complexity, or mature workflows already aligned to a niche industry system. However, these platforms can become expensive and rigid when project volume fluctuates, when cross-functional integration is weak, or when modernization requires extensive third-party tooling.
| Evaluation Area | Odoo | Traditional Construction ERP Licensing Model |
|---|---|---|
| Licensing structure | Modular and generally flexible for phased adoption | Often module-based plus user tiers, add-ons, and service dependencies |
| Project-based scaling | Well suited for adding functions and users as operations expand | Can become costly when scaling across entities, departments, or field teams |
| Customization | High flexibility through configuration and custom development | Often possible but more expensive and partner-dependent |
| Deployment options | Online, Odoo.sh, and on-premise options available | Varies by vendor; some are cloud-first, others remain infrastructure-heavy |
| Integration model | Broad API and app ecosystem | May rely on proprietary connectors or third-party middleware |
| TCO profile | Often favorable for midmarket firms seeking consolidation | Can rise significantly with add-ons, consulting, and upgrade complexity |
Licensing comparison: why construction businesses feel ERP cost differently
Construction companies experience ERP licensing differently from product-centric businesses because headcount, project volume, subcontractor activity, and reporting needs fluctuate over time. A contractor may need broader system access during mobilization, tighter cost tracking during execution, and more finance-heavy usage during billing and closeout. Licensing models that appear affordable at contract signature can become restrictive when project managers, site supervisors, procurement staff, and finance users all need coordinated access.
Odoo generally offers a more coherent licensing approach for organizations that want to standardize operations across estimating, CRM, purchasing, inventory, accounting, HR, and project management. Instead of maintaining multiple disconnected systems with separate contracts, many firms can consolidate into one platform. Traditional construction ERP models may still offer strong depth in certain construction-specific functions, but licensing often expands through additional modules, implementation services, reporting tools, mobile apps, and external integrations.
Pricing considerations in real-world construction environments
Pricing analysis should include more than software subscription rates. Construction firms should model at least five cost layers: software licensing, implementation and process design, customization, integrations, and ongoing support. Odoo often compares well when a business wants to replace several point solutions at once. A traditional construction ERP may look competitive if the organization only needs a narrow accounting core, but costs can increase materially when project controls, document workflows, mobile approvals, BI reporting, or equipment management are added.
| Cost Dimension | Odoo Consideration | Traditional Construction ERP Consideration |
|---|---|---|
| Base licensing | Usually predictable for modular ERP adoption | Can vary widely by user type, module, and edition |
| Implementation services | Moderate to high depending on process redesign and custom scope | Often high, especially for construction-specific configuration |
| Customization cost | Generally efficient when built on standard Odoo architecture | Often expensive due to proprietary frameworks or specialist consultants |
| Third-party add-ons | May be reduced if core processes are consolidated in Odoo | Frequently required for field mobility, reporting, or workflow extensions |
| Upgrade cost | Manageable with disciplined architecture and governance | Can be substantial if customizations and integrations are extensive |
| Infrastructure cost | Flexible depending on Online, Odoo.sh, or on-premise | Depends on vendor model; some require higher hosting or managed service spend |
Total cost of ownership: the hidden economics of contract complexity
TCO in construction ERP is heavily influenced by contract structures. Lump-sum projects, cost-plus billing, progress billing, retention, change orders, subcontractor back charges, and multi-entity reporting all create process complexity that can either be handled natively or pushed into manual workarounds. The more manual the workaround, the higher the operational cost. This is where many ERP programs underperform: the software may be licensed affordably, but finance teams, project accountants, and operations managers absorb the cost through spreadsheets, duplicate entry, and delayed reporting.
Odoo tends to deliver stronger TCO outcomes when the business values platform consolidation and process standardization. If CRM, procurement, project management, accounting, approvals, inventory, maintenance, and HR can operate in one environment, administrative overhead falls and reporting consistency improves. Traditional construction ERP platforms may still justify their cost when they provide highly specialized construction controls that would otherwise require significant custom development. The key is to compare not only software cost, but the cost of fragmentation versus the cost of specialization.
Implementation complexity: construction ERP success depends on process design
Implementation complexity should be evaluated by business model, not company size alone. A mid-sized general contractor with multiple legal entities, subcontractor-heavy delivery, and decentralized purchasing may be more complex than a larger but operationally standardized builder. Odoo implementations are usually most successful when the organization is willing to redesign workflows around a unified data model. That includes standardizing project codes, approval chains, procurement rules, cost categories, billing triggers, and reporting structures.
Traditional construction ERP implementations can be advantageous when the business already operates according to the software's native construction logic. However, they often become slower and more expensive when cross-functional integration is required beyond accounting and job costing. If CRM, service, inventory, equipment, HR, or document workflows sit outside the core ERP, implementation complexity shifts from configuration to integration management.
- Odoo implementation complexity is typically moderate for standardized firms and high for organizations requiring extensive construction-specific customization.
- Traditional construction ERP complexity is often high when legacy processes, niche accounting rules, and multiple third-party systems must be preserved.
- The biggest implementation risk in either model is unclear process ownership between finance, operations, procurement, and project teams.
Customization and integration: where platform architecture matters most
Construction businesses rarely fit a perfect out-of-the-box model. They need workflows for RFIs, submittals, change orders, project cost commitments, retention tracking, equipment allocation, site purchasing, and progress billing visibility. Odoo's advantage is architectural flexibility. It can be configured and extended to support project-driven operations while maintaining a unified user experience and shared data structure. This makes it attractive for firms that want ERP to reflect how they actually operate rather than forcing every process into a rigid template.
That said, customization should be governed carefully. Excessive tailoring can undermine upgradeability and increase support costs. Traditional construction ERP platforms may offer stronger native depth in some construction accounting scenarios, reducing the need for custom development in those areas. But they may require more integration work to connect CRM, procurement approvals, mobile field capture, document management, or executive dashboards.
Deployment comparison: cloud flexibility versus infrastructure constraints
Deployment strategy is increasingly important for construction firms with distributed teams, remote project sites, and growing cybersecurity expectations. Odoo offers meaningful flexibility through Odoo Online, Odoo.sh, and on-premise deployment. This allows businesses to align hosting with governance, customization needs, internal IT maturity, and compliance preferences. For many midmarket firms, Odoo.sh provides a practical middle ground between cloud convenience and development control.
Traditional construction ERP deployment options vary significantly. Some vendors have modernized into cloud delivery, while others still carry legacy hosting assumptions or managed infrastructure dependencies. Construction executives should evaluate not only where the software runs, but how deployment affects upgrade cadence, integration architecture, disaster recovery, data ownership, and the ability to support acquisitions or new entities quickly.
| Deployment Factor | Odoo | Traditional Construction ERP |
|---|---|---|
| Cloud options | Strong flexibility across hosted and self-managed models | Vendor-dependent; some are mature, others less flexible |
| Customization in cloud | Best controlled through Odoo.sh or on-premise | May be limited in SaaS editions or require vendor services |
| Upgrade control | More controllable with the right deployment model | Often tied to vendor release cycles and service contracts |
| IT overhead | Low to moderate depending on deployment choice | Moderate to high in legacy-hosted or hybrid environments |
| Multi-entity expansion | Generally well suited for structured growth | Can be effective but may require additional licensing and setup effort |
Scalability for project-based growth and contract diversification
Scalability in construction is not just about transaction volume. It is about whether the ERP can support more projects, more entities, more contract types, more field users, and more reporting complexity without forcing a major replatform. Odoo is often a strong fit for companies moving from founder-led operations or disconnected software into a more disciplined operating model. It scales well when growth requires standardization across sales, estimating handoff, procurement, project execution, and finance.
Alternative construction ERP platforms may scale effectively in organizations with highly mature construction accounting disciplines and stable process patterns. They may be less attractive for businesses that are diversifying into service, maintenance, prefabrication, real estate development, or multi-business operating models where broader ERP flexibility matters.
Which businesses should choose Odoo
Odoo is usually the better choice for construction businesses that want to unify commercial, operational, and financial workflows in one platform. This includes growing general contractors, specialty contractors, design-build firms, fit-out companies, and project-based businesses that need stronger process visibility without adopting a highly rigid legacy stack. It is especially compelling when leadership wants to reduce software sprawl, improve reporting consistency, and retain flexibility for future process changes.
Which businesses may prefer a traditional construction ERP alternative
A traditional construction ERP may be the better fit for firms with highly specialized construction accounting requirements, deeply entrenched job costing practices, or regulatory and payroll complexities already well served by an industry-specific platform. It may also suit organizations that prioritize niche construction depth over enterprise-wide process consolidation, particularly if they already have stable integrations and internal teams trained around that ecosystem.
Realistic business scenarios and platform selection guidance
Scenario one: a regional contractor using separate systems for CRM, estimating, purchasing, accounting, and timesheets wants better project margin visibility. Odoo is often the stronger option because consolidation can reduce manual reconciliation and improve executive reporting. Scenario two: a mature construction accounting team with complex union payroll and highly specific cost code structures may prefer a specialized alternative if those requirements are already deeply supported. Scenario three: a fast-growing specialty contractor expanding into maintenance services and multiple subsidiaries will often benefit from Odoo's broader ERP flexibility and deployment options.
- Choose Odoo when the strategic priority is platform consolidation, process standardization, and flexible scaling across project and back-office operations.
- Choose a traditional construction ERP when niche construction accounting depth outweighs the need for broader enterprise integration.
- Run a fit-gap assessment before selection, especially around job costing, billing logic, subcontractor workflows, payroll dependencies, and executive reporting.
Migration considerations: moving from legacy construction systems to Odoo
Migration planning should focus on data quality, process redesign, and reporting continuity. Construction firms often carry inconsistent project structures, duplicate vendor records, fragmented cost codes, and historical billing data spread across multiple systems. A successful move to Odoo requires rationalizing master data, defining future-state workflows, and deciding what historical detail must be migrated versus archived. The migration should also address open projects, subcontract commitments, retention balances, and in-flight billing cycles.
From an executive perspective, migration is not only a technical event. It is an operating model transition. The strongest programs establish governance across finance, operations, procurement, and project leadership early, then phase rollout according to business risk. For many construction firms, a phased migration by entity, function, or project lifecycle stage is more realistic than a single big-bang deployment.
Final decision guidance for construction leaders
The right construction ERP licensing model depends on whether your business needs specialization, consolidation, or a balance of both. Odoo is generally the stronger strategic option when growth, flexibility, and cross-functional integration matter more than preserving legacy process habits. Traditional construction ERP alternatives remain valid when highly specific construction accounting depth is the primary requirement and the organization is comfortable with a more specialized ecosystem. The best decision comes from evaluating licensing in the context of implementation effort, TCO, deployment flexibility, and the operational realities of project-based scaling.
